BURNED WOOD

Douglas brushed

We produce Burned Wood Douglas brushed by carefully brushing off the charcoal layer after our preservation process, the controlled surface burning. This reveals the wood's grain pattern with a fantastic color contrast and deep relief. As a finish, we use Burned Wood Stain Natural, a water-based transparent stain with UV blocking produced in the Netherlands. The stain protects the wood against UV radiation, fungi, and weathering, preserving the wood color for a longer duration. Over time, a natural gray patina develops.

Douglas, Local Dutch Wood

The Douglas wood we use for Burned Wood is sourced from the Dutch State Forestry and comes from 100% FSC-managed forests. Douglas has a beautiful wood structure with a distinct grain pattern and knots in the wood.

Burned Wood Douglas brushed is also available with fire class B. (Euroclass) European burnt wood Douglas cladding with fire class B-s3, d0 according to EN13501-1, and certified according to EN14195.

Specifications and Options

  • Application: Interior and exterior
  • Length: 2.5 - 5 meters (other sizes on request)
  • Width: 50 - 180 mm (other sizes on request)
  • Thickness: 21 - 45mm (other sizes on request)
  • Wood Type: Douglas Fir, from the Dutch State forestry, FSC®.
  • Origin: Netherlands
  • Specific Gravity: 550 kg/m3
  • Fire Class: B-s3, d0 according to EN13501-1, and certified according to EN14195. (after optional treatment)
  • Maintenance: 1-3 years
  • Optional Treatment: Other semi-transparent color shades or Fire Class B
  • Installation: Stainless steel screws with a black head
